FT/Goldman Sachs Book of the Year

2012 Financial Times / Goldman Sachs Business Book of the Year


A while back I posted the finalists for the FT/GS Business Book of the Year on the Business Center's Facebook page, and the winner has been announced: Private Empire: ExxonMobil and American Power, by Steve Coll. Coll has previously written about the CIA and the Bin Laden family, and again in this book sheds significant light into something shrouded in secrecy: America's largest, and arguably the most private, publicly traded company.
